origin legend of keeping healthy
Wudang Kung Fu emerges as the
demand of health in Taoism.
Adopting realistic attitude
towards life, extremely devoting
much attention to this life,
and pursuing happiness, wealth,
longevity and living forever,
which are held in esteem in
Taoism. Besides, it is thought
in Taoism that the ordinary
persons are likely to become
celestial being in the contemporary
age rather than in the posthumous
time. The aim of becoming celestial
being can be achieved through
the cultivation of the spirit
and flesh.
In Taoism, cultivating to be
supernatural being demands the
practice of vital energy that
needs breathing exercises. Then,
practicing shadowboxing is in
need. The motions of Wushu are
led into the practice of breathing
that is also permeated in the
process of shadowboxing, thus
forming the Kung Fu mechanism:
Gongfu excising inside and shadowboxing
outside, combing inside and
outside but taking inside as
the dominant factor. Gradually
the complete system of Wudang
Kung Fu comes into being.
The thinking-way of Taoism is
to attach importance to intuition
and comprehension. Grasp the
features of objects by mental
perception in order to understand
the essence profoundly, which
is the basic characteristic
of the thinking of Wudang Kung
Fu. Movements, offence and defence
of Wudang Kung Fu can be imparted,
viewed and learned. However,
the different mood, charm, internal
temperament and vigor are comprehended
deeply in the repeatedly practice
and ponderousness after perceived
by intuition. This thorough
process is penetrated with hardworking,
studying with concentration
and proficiency. Only after
accumulative experience can
the charm be captured. Meanwhile,
the entry to a certain mood
is the key to true essence of
the occult. The way through
intuition and practice reflects
the profound influence that
Wudang Kung Fu exerts on the
flesh, spirit, thought and ethics,
and represents the social purpose
of effect and cultivation.
Wudang Boxing, a unity of internal
and outside kung fu, contains
the social function of self-defence.
The offence and defence at all
times and all countries advocate
the force, tempo, intensity,
bigness winning smallness, quickness
winning slowness, and strongness
winning weakness. But only in
Wudang boxing are bigness, smallness,
quickness, slowness, strongness
and weakness looked at dialectically.
The saying of
"Four teals lifting a thousand
jin" and the moving mode:
conquering toughness by gentleness,
defeating strongness by weakness,
subduing quickness by slowness---have
enriched the theory and practice
in the
East and West and have contributed
to the world culture. The strategic
characteristics and their social
efficacy coincide with the purpose
of preserving health, which
is the fundamental differentiation
between Wudang Boxing and other
genres, and is the essential
dynamic factor in expanding
function of improving health.
In the theory of Wudang Kung
Fu, the cultivation of essence,
energy, spirit and their relationship
are held significantly. It is
thought that essence is the
root, providing the basic substance
for the body growth, that energy
is the carrier to essence, which
is circulating through the whole
body by the form of energy and
supplies the energy to physiology
continuously, and that spirit
is the manifestation and result
of the endless energy, which
can maintain the thought and
other activities. A system of
requirements result in this
principle. On the one hand,
the potentiality of self-defence
is tapped; on the other hand,
make use of motions of offence
and defence to harmonize the
vital energy and blood, to mitigate
the collateral channels, and
to incorporate Wushu and health,
by means of which the vitality
is reinforced to accomplish
the aim of longevity. The theory
of preserving health, developed
and perfected, is the result
of combining the strong desire
for living and pleasure-seeking.
The
orbit theory of round movement
The arc movement is taken as
the motion requirement and moving
orbit in Wudang Kung Fu, which
is the expansion of philosophical
thought of Taoism.
Laozi said, "All the things
come from something, something
from nothing".The Classic
of the Virtue of the Tao by
Laozi, the seventieth chapter.Thus,
a transformable circle is formed.
As for Diagram of the Taiji,
it is a circle of transformation
between Yin and Yang. Since
the relation between the creation
in the universe and Taoism is
manifested in a mutually transformable
circle, moving orbit is the
best diagram of the infinitude.
Naturally, Wudang Kung Fu chooses
this optimizing pattern having
great vitality to preserve the
health, which is also the root
cause for attaching importance
to the circle.
In view of the aim? Concerning
the effect and pursuit of the
shadowboxing, Wudang Boxing
devotes much attention to the
circle and arc in the permutations
and combinations of motions
and moving orbit, such as Eight-diagram
Palm laying on circle. The moving
orbit is that a big circle contains
a small one and then there is
no circle in form; however,
the circle still exists in the
mind. Circle or arc is permeated
in each motion: directing palm,
rising legs, walking, posing
feet, even practising strength
by thought, and so on. In this
case, the Eight-diagram Palm
is called circle-interlocking
palm.
The Diagram of Taiji, applied
to the boxing by the founder
of Chinese boxing, has become
the badge of Taiji Boxing. Accordingly,
the mode and route are the arc?
Most of them are curve and circle.
There are three-circle rhymes
in the Form-and-will Boxing:
the chest should be round and
sinking, the back round like
a monkey, and fist round like
a triangle, which are three
normative requirements and show
the significance of the circle.
Taiji Boxing, Form-and-will
Boxing, and Eight-diagram Palm
are based on arc, which is not
only manifested in the route
and pose, but also in the feature
of body movement. So, the movement
going around about the waist
taken as an axis is penetrated
with circle and arc. With the
change of motions, all kinds
of arc movements, in other words,
a big arc containing a small
one, a big circle containing
a small one, the flat circle,
the standing circle, the octant,
are formed. It is reasonable
to say the rule of those is
a circle.
The explosive force of Wudang
Boxing is related to the arc.
Taiji Boxing shows spiral force,
Form-and-will Boxing drilling
force, and the Eight-diagram
Palm twinning force. All that
makes the strength bold and
vigorous, which is the special
requirement of conquering toughness
by gentleness.
Concerning the attack and defence
in the shadowboxing, the force
is steadier going in the spinning
approach and it is not easy
to be caught by the opponent.
In the defence, the application
of the circle and arc can augment
the enduring area of the strength
and prolong the functionary
time nicely up to the realm
of "four taels lifting
a thousand Jin".
In one word, the orbit of arc
movement is the foundation of
the boxing, weapon, pattern
and standard.
